Tevin Coleman Has High Ankle Sprain

San Francisco 49ers head coach Kyle Shanahan said that running back Tevin Coleman (ankle) has a high ankle sprain. Coleman isn't expected to play this week, and the team will take it week-to-week with him. The San Jose Mercury News' Cam Inman doesn't think Injured Reserve is a possibility. Devin Funchess Has Surgery, Will Go On IR

Indianapolis Colts head coach Frank Reich confirmed that wide receiver Devin Funchess (collarbone) had surgery to fix his broken collarbone and will go on Injured Reserve. Jaguars Trade For Joshua Dobbs

The Jacksonville Jaguars are acquiring quarterback Joshua Dobbs from the Steelers on Monday in exchange for a 2020 fifth-round pick, according to sources.
